We arrived and went to counter. Was told our table was at front. Was not seated or asked if wanted drinks. Had to go up and order drinks. The food was not great. The seafood pasta was only shrimp/prawn pasta. The lamb rump was just that. Well it did have a soggy rosti the meat was stacked on. The place was so loud we could not even hear ourselves and the wobbly table was annoying. When we paid and said about the pasta missing the seafood the waitress went to the chef and came back saying it was all there. Not sure where the clams and scallops were that he mentioned. But the waitress said I think the chef was lying!

Small quaint restaurant that happily took a walk-in table for 2 for dinner on a Tuesday - I suggest larger groups book. Meals had good flavours. Seafood chowder lacked seafood and needed more than just shrimp. Steak was cooked as requested and was a very generous size. Chicken roulade was good but the sauce was very sweet for my tastes. Satisfying meal.

On the way back from Waihi we stopped in Morrisville to get something to eat. Few places open and we decided to try this Village Kitchen. Just 5 of us there, no other customers. But the food was fantastic, I ordered the prawn salad, my kids shared the smoked shrimp pasta and my wife picked the salmon. Everything was tasty and well served. Staff very kind and efficient. Price wise is the cheapest , but considering the quality and flavors, it was totally worth.

Visited as a family group on Saturday night. It was busy, but not packed, so a nice atmosphere. Good service, prompt and polite. The entree, garlic bread, was big and two was too much for five people. The mains were all nice; tasty and well presented. The desserts were amazing. Maybe a little expensive, but definitely worth it. We'll come back. Update - visited several more times, still very good.
